Hyungwon Hwang d41b7a3a74 exynos: Don't use DRM_EXYNOS_GEM_{MAP_OFFSET/MMAP} ioctls
The ioctl DRM_EXYNOS_GEM_MAP_OFFSET and DRM_EXYNOS_GEM_MMAP are removed from
the linux kernel. This patch modifies libdrm and libkms to use drm generic
ioctls instead of the removed ioctls.

v2: The original patch was erroneous. In case the MODE_MAP_DUMB ioctl failed
    it would return the retvalue as a void-pointer. Users of libdrm would then
    happily use that ptr, eventually leading to a segfault. Change this to
    return NULL in that case and also restore the previous behaviour of logging
    to stderr.
    The other error was that 'bo->vaddr' was never filled with the mapped
    buffer address. Hence exynos_bo_map still returned NULL even if the
    buffer mapping succeeded.
